Priority Outcomes for Illinois Student Veterans in Computer Science Scholarship Program

The Scholarship for Student Veterans of America is a vital initiative that provides financial assistance to student veterans pursuing university degrees in computer science. In Illinois, this program is particularly significant due to the state's strong presence of technology and innovation hubs. The Illinois Department of Veterans' Affairs and the Illinois Science and Technology Coalition are key stakeholders in promoting this initiative. One of the primary outcomes of this program is to increase the number of veterans in the state's tech workforce, addressing the growing demand for skilled professionals in this field.

Addressing the Tech Talent Shortage in Illinois

Illinois is home to a thriving tech industry, with major hubs in Chicago and Champaign-Urbana. The state's economy is driven by a diverse range of sectors, including finance, healthcare, and manufacturing, all of which rely heavily on technology. However, Illinois faces a significant tech talent shortage, with many companies struggling to find skilled professionals to fill open positions. By supporting student veterans in computer science programs, this scholarship helps to address this shortage and drive economic growth in the state. In fact, a report by the Illinois Technology Association found that the state's tech industry is projected to grow by 10% over the next five years, creating a high demand for skilled workers.

Fostering Innovation and Entrepreneurship in Illinois' Frontier Counties

In addition to addressing the tech talent shortage, this scholarship also aims to foster innovation and entrepreneurship in Illinois' frontier counties. The southern and western regions of the state are characterized by rural areas and small towns, which often lack access to resources and funding. By supporting student veterans in these areas, the program helps to build a more diverse and inclusive tech ecosystem. For example, the Illinois Finance Authority's Rural Economic Development Initiative provides funding and technical assistance to businesses in rural areas, and this scholarship can help to support the development of tech talent in these regions.
